eg.lat is a proper place name listed with Zoar and Horonaim in announcements concerning Moab.

The attested form functions as a proper place name in geographic lists associated with Moab: it is named after Zoar in Isaiah 15:5 and alongside Zoar and Horonaim in Jeremiah 48:34.

Senses in use

  1. A place named in Moab-related geographic lists · dominant

    Both occurrences are tagged Noun · Proper and appear in sequences of place names. In Isaiah 15:5 the APB renders the clause “to Eglath-shelishiyah the third” after Zoar; in Jeremiah 48:34 it renders “from Zoar to Horonaim and Eglath-shelishiyah” amid a cry and desolation announcement.

In the Anselm Project Bible: The APB presents the term as “Eglath-shelishiyah” in both verses, once with “the third.” That added wording cannot be assigned to the lemma alone.
